Vue无法直接编辑i视频怎么办_无法直接编辑_要实现这一功能你需要借助第三方视频编辑库或服务
Vue无法直接编辑iPhone视频,怎么办?
Vue主要用于构建用户界面和单页面应用,所以它本身并不能直接编辑视频,特别是iPhone的视频。要实现这一功能,你需要借助第三方视频编辑库或服务。
实现视频编辑功能的4个关键步骤
- 选择合适的视频编辑库
- 集成库与Vue框架
- 实现编辑功能
- 处理编辑后的视频输出
接下来,我们逐一看看这些步骤的具体内容。
一、选择合适的视频编辑库
你需要挑选一个适合的视频编辑库。以下是一些常见的选项:
库 | 特点 |
---|---|
FFmpeg.js | 强大且灵活,但学习曲线较陡 |
Video.js | 侧重播放功能,但可通过插件扩展编辑功能 |
Plyr | 同样侧重播放功能,可扩展编辑功能 |
Kapwing | 在线视频编辑平台,可通过API集成 |
选择哪个库取决于你的具体项目需求。
二、集成库与Vue框架
确定了库之后,就要将它集成到Vue项目中。以下是一个使用FFmpeg.js的示例:
- 安装FFmpeg.js
- 在Vue组件中引入和初始化FFmpeg.js
这个过程涉及到一些基本的设置,但具体操作可以根据库的文档来操作。
三、实现编辑功能
集成库后,接下来就是实现编辑功能了。以下是一个剪辑视频的例子:
- 创建一个方法来处理视频剪辑
- 在模板中添加相应的HTML
具体实现细节可以根据你选择的库和具体需求来定。
四、处理编辑后的视频输出
编辑完视频后,你需要处理输出视频文件。以下是一个简单的下载示例:
- 添加下载按钮和方法
- 实现下载方法
这样,用户就可以下载他们编辑后的视频文件了。
通过以上步骤,你就可以在Vue应用中实现iPhone视频的编辑功能了。虽然Vue本身不能直接编辑视频,但借助第三方库,你可以实现强大的视频编辑功能。
最后,根据具体需求选择合适的库,并充分利用其功能和API,是提高效率的关键。